It’s not the lop-sided affair that many expected. AT least, not yet. After 30 minutes of play, it’s Patriots 17, Colts 3. It was a slow start for the Patriots, getting an early field goal, then standing for 10 minutes as the Colts kept the ball on a lengthy field goal drive. Finally, tied at 3, they got it together. Using their hurry-up look, they drove 86 yards in 16 plays, taking a 10-3 lead thanks to an 11-yard score by TE Rob Gronkowski and his epic spike. After a brutally terrible three-and-out for the Colts, the Pats ruled the two-minute drive to go up 17-3 after a BenJarvus Green-Ellis 1-yard score to cap a 64-yard march. QB Tom Brady is 16 of 21 for 158 yards and a TD, while Wes Welker has five catches for 67 yards. Gronkowski has three catches for 34 yards. Oh, and Chad Ochocinco has a 12-yard catch. Patriots TE Rob Gronkowski was celebrated in yesterday’s 31-24 win over the Colts for setting the single-season TD record for tight ends. Then, he had it taken away, which he took in stride. It was a weird day for Gronk, and he was only 1 of 3 on Gronk Spikes. In my video, he explained it all:

Patriots' Gronkowski ties NFL TE touchdowns mark

Rob Gronkowski tied the NFL record for touchdowns by a tight end on Sunday. With two scores against the woeful Indianapolis Colts, the New England Patriots star has 13 on the season. He is now tied with Vernon Davis of the San Francisco 49ers (2009) and Antonio Gates of the San Diego Chargers (2004) for the honor.
